What Is Re-Credentialing?

Re-credentialing is a periodic process required by insurance payers and healthcare organizations to re-verify a provider’s qualifications, licenses, and practice history. Typically occurring every 2 to 3 years, re-credentialing ensures that providers meet the ongoing standards for participation in health plans and hospital networks.
